If you go down to the streets today, you're sure for a big surprise. You'll find:
Coke, fanta, pepsi and red bull cans
Water, lucozade and coke bottles
Maoam wrappers
McDonald's packaging
Coffee cups
Cigarette stubs
Cigarette packaging
Pizza boxes
Discarded food
Discarded clothing
Plastic pint cups
Chippy shop packaging
And a GAZILLION DISPOSABLE MASKS!!!
8 carrier bags and two trips later, with some sorting for recycling, I was done.
